The original Smokie band, founded in Bradford, England, was formed by school friends Chris Norman and Alan Silson in the 1970s. They quickly gained fame with their signature style and catchy tunes, earning a place in the hearts of fans worldwide. Smokie’s worldwide success includes more than 40 million records sold, with songs that have stood the test of time and continue to be celebrated by fans of all ages.
The tragic loss of lead singer Alan Barton in 1995 left a hole in the world of rock music, but Spirit of Smokie ensures his legacy lives on. Alan’s son, Dean Barton, now leads the tribute band, taking on his father’s role and continuing to bring the Smokie sound to life for a new generation of fans.
